Output d4e81c03e545a31b9c26c2f99b0ec4091859f99b796375c9f9e63ba5c51b9744:11

value
5266669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c3599e61da684463e0e21989d35e89d96514f0 OP_EQUAL
address
3DtHpDcMcZCby5KE3358cSoDMJncNqgpUk
transaction
d4e81c03e545a31b9c26c2f99b0ec4091859f99b796375c9f9e63ba5c51b9744
confirmations
665
spent
true